The LastRunOutcome property returns the execution completion status of the job or job step for the most recent execution attempt.
object.LastRunOutcome
object
Expression that evaluates to an object in the Applies To list
Long, enumerated
Read-only
HRESULT GetLastRunOutcome(SQLDMO_COMPLETION_TYPE* pRetVal);
Interpret the LastRunOutcome property using these values.
Constant | Value | Description |
---|---|---|
SQLDMOJobOutcome_Cancelled | 3 | Execution canceled by user action. |
SQLDMOJobOutcome_Failed | 0 | Execution failed. |
SQLDMOJobOutcome_InProgress | 4 | Job or job step is executing. |
SQLDMOJobOutcome_Succeeded | 1 | Execution succeeded. |
SQLDMOJobOutcome_Unknown | 5 | Unable to determine execution state. |